Analysis of curve inflection point model

 

 It is best to analyze the indicators in Figure 1-2 first, and then analyze them comprehensively. Such steps are easier to understand and the ideas are clearer. Next, let's analyze it with Xiaobai. The analysis ideas are as follows.

1) The X axis represents the number of concurrent users, and the Y axis represents resource utilization, throughput, and response time. From left to right, the X-axis and Y-axis areas are the light pressure area, the heavy pressure area, and the inflection point area.

2) Then analyze one by one, and understand according to the performance terms and indicators learned earlier.As the number of concurrent users increases, the response time in the light pressure zone does not change much, it is relatively flat, and it shows a trend of growth after entering the heavy pressure zone. The slope rate increases after entering the inflection point area, and the response time increases sharply.

3) Next, look at the throughput. As the number of concurrent users increases, the throughput increases. After entering the heavy pressure zone, it gradually stabilizes, and after reaching the inflection point zone, it drops sharply.

4) Similarly, as the number of concurrent users increases, the resource utilization rate gradually rises and finally reaches saturation.

5) Finally, all indicators are merged together for analysis. As the number of concurrent users increases, the throughput and resource utilization rate increase, indicating that the system is actively processing, so the response time does not increase significantly and is in a relatively good state. However, as the number of concurrent users continued to increase, the pressure continued to increase, throughput and resource utilization reached saturation, and then the throughput dropped sharply, resulting in a sharp increase in response time. The junction of the light pressure zone and the heavy pressure zone is the optimal number of concurrent users of the system, because various resources are fully utilized and the response is fast; and the junction point of the heavy pressure zone and the inflection point zone is the maximum number of concurrent users of the system. Because beyond this point, the system performance will drop sharply or even crash.
